Parri is a Village located in the Taluka of Dhaka, in the district of Purba Champaran district, in the state of Bihar state with a total population of 5290. There are 997 houses in the Village.

There are total of 2736 male persons and 2554 females and a total number of 1057 children below 6 years in Parri.
The percentage of male population is 51.72%.
The percentage of female population is 48.28%.
The percentage of child population is 19.98%.
